Lapidar Lladrovci (born 15 December 1990) is a Kosovan former professional footballer who played as a midfielder. He spend the majority of his career in Kosovo, most notably with Feronikeli, whom he captained. [1]
In January 2015, Lladrovci went to a trial with Albanian Superliga club Tirana which he successfully passed and signed a pre-contract, [2] but was sent on loan at his previous club Feronikeli until the end of the season. [3] [4]
On 1 February 2016, Lladrovci joined fellow Albanian Superliga side as a free transfer. [5]
Lladrovci announced his retirement at the end of 2024–25 season, having played only 11 league matches with Feronikeli. [6]
Lladrovci made his international debut for Kosovo on 12 January 2020 in a friendly match against Sweden, which finished as a 0–1 loss. [7]
He is the son of the current Kosovar ambassador to Albania Ramiz Lladrovci. [8]
